Golden Buttermilk Waffle Breakfast Sliders

These mini sandwiches combine warm, fluffy waffles with crispy bacon and sunny-side-up eggs, all drizzled with sweet maple syrup. Ingredients
  

2 cups all-purpose flour

2 tbsp sugar

1 tbsp baking powder

1/2 tsp baking soda

1/2 tsp salt

2 large eggs

2 cups buttermilk

1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ted

1 tsp vanilla extract

8 slices of crispy bacon

4 fried eggs (cooked sunny-side up preferred)

1 cup arugula or baby spinach

Maple syrup (for drizzling)

Optional: sliced avocado or cheese

Instructions
 

Preheat Waffle Iron: Heat your waffle iron according to the manufacturer's instructions, and lightly grease it with non-stick cooking spray or a little melted butter.

    Make the Waffle Batter: In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. In another bowl, whisk together the eggs, buttermilk, melted butter, and vanilla extract until smooth.

      Combine Mixtures: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ir just until combined. Do not overmix; a few lumps are okay.

        Cook Waffles: Pour a generous amount of batter onto the preheated waffle iron (about 1 cup, depending on the size of your iron). Close the lid and cook until the waffles are golden brown and crisp, about 4-5 minutes. Repeat with the remaining batter, placing cooked waffles on a wire rack to keep them warm.

          Prepare Breakfast Fillings: While the waffles are cooking, fry the bacon in a skillet over medium heat until crispy. Remove from the skillet and drain on paper towels. In the same skillet, fry the eggs to your liking (sunny-side-up is recommended).

            Assemble the Sliders: For each slider, stack a waffle on the bottom, followed by a slice of crispy bacon, a fried egg, a handful of arugula, and an optional avocado slice or cheese. Top with another waffle.

              Serve and Enjoy: Drizzle the breakfast sliders with maple syrup just before serving. These can be enjoyed warm or at room temperature.

                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 mins | 30 mins | 4 servings
